Tests con HTTP2 y WordPress
Bueno, hoy un día de lluvia he decidido revivir un poco el blog con 3 post seguidos, aparte de poner el SSL he decidido actualizar nginx a la versión 1.9.12 y ya que he hecho el cambio he dicho, por que no poner HTTP2 ?
Nginx soporta http2 desde la versión 1.9.5 ahora bien, hay o no hay mejora de velocidad ?
Toma en cuenta que hay un SSL pues si, hay mejora de velocidad, no mucho pero hay, en mi caso haciendo el test desde ping doom, he notado mejoría de 200 milisegundos, en términos generales se navega un poco mejor también, tal vez no se perciba mucho pero si hay mejoría eso esta claro, si no no le darían tanto bombo a http2…
En fin, les traigo las capturas del antes y del después.
Sin HTTP2 pero con nginx 1.9
Unos minutos después con HTTP2
Lamentablemente no tengo hhvm en estos momentos ya que en freebsd no lo he hecho funcionar aún, pero en el último test que había hecho instalando hhvm mejoro también 200ms, así que sería la bomba y ya si le pongo varnish el delay sería mínimo.
Notas
skamasle.com actualmente funciona tanto con SSL como sin SSL, si quieren probar HTTP2 tienen que entrar por SSL, lo curioso es que HTTP2 trabaja sin SSL pero los navegadores no aceptan HTTP2 si el sitio no tiene SSL, supongo que esto lo implementaron para que todos los sitios usen SSL y hacer un internet más seguro, aunque en mi opinión personal no hace mucha falta tomando encuenta que hay sitios( como este ) que no pide login a los usuarios ni nada por el estilo, por lo tanto no hace falta SSL no hay que ocultar nada.
Sin más me despido y pronto más pruebas 🙂
Esto es igual con lets ecrypt, lo has probado?
Acabo de ver el certificado que usas, fail para mi.
Si como has podido ver va con lets encrypt 🙂
En principio da igual el certificado, puede ser hasta un certificado self signed y funcionará http2 es lo que los navegadores exigen, que este cifrado.
Un saludo.